Boomer’s Legacy

The annual Boomer’s Legacy Ride has begun. The riders left the Comox Valley this morning.

Before leaving the Valley, the riders stopped at the grave site of Andrew “Boomer” Eykelenboom, who died while serving in Afghanistan in 2006.

His mother, Maureen Eykelenboom says it’s amazing to see everyone come together for this event. She says the cyclists raised funds, all in honor of fallen military members and those serving the country.

The riders will finish in Nanaimo today and then ride to Victoria tomorrow.
